SECURITY_IMPERSONATION_LEVEL 열거형(wudfddi.h)

[UMDF에만 적용]

SECURITY_IMPERSONATION_LEVEL 열거형에는 보안 가장 수준을 식별하는 값이 포함되어 있습니다.

Syntax

typedef enum _SECURITY_IMPERSONATION_LEVEL {
  SecurityAnonymous,
  SecurityIdentification,
  SecurityImpersonation,
  SecurityDelegation
} SECURITY_IMPERSONATION_LEVEL;

상수

 
SecurityAnonymous
드라이버는 클라이언트를 가장하거나 식별할 수 없습니다.
SecurityIdentification
드라이버는 클라이언트의 ID 및 권한을 가져올 수 있지만 클라이언트를 가장할 수는 없습니다.
SecurityImpersonation
드라이버는 로컬 시스템에서 클라이언트의 보안 컨텍스트를 가장할 수 있습니다.
SecurityDelegation
드라이버는 원격 시스템에서 클라이언트의 보안 컨텍스트를 가장할 수 있습니다.

설명

UMDF의 가장에 대한 자세한 내용은 클라이언트 가장 처리를 참조하세요.

UMDF 드라이버는 SECURITY_IMPERSONATION_LEVEL 값 중 하나를 IWDFIoRequest::Impersonate 메서드에 제공하여 보안 가장 수준을 설정합니다.

보안 가장 수준에 대한 자세한 내용은 Microsoft Windows SDK 설명서의 SECURITY_IMPERSONATION_LEVEL 열거형 형식을 참조하세요.

요구 사항

요구 사항
헤더 wudfddi.h(Wudfddi.h 포함)

추가 정보

IWDFIoRequest::Impersonate